A First War 134Th Infantry Battalion "48Th Highlanders" Glengarry Badge Hold On October 2Browning copper, voided, maker marked "ELLIS BROS TORONTO" on the reverse, 46 mm x 58. 5 mm, intact lugs, very light contact, extremely fine. Footnote: The Battalion was raised and mobilized in Toronto, Ontario under the authority of G. O. 151, December 22, 1915.
